TAMPA, FLORIDA – AC Milan midfielder Keisuke Honda scored twice and Yoshito Okubo grabbed a dramatic late winner on Friday as Japan came from 2-0 down to beat Zambia 4-3 in their final warm-up for the upcoming World Cup finals.
Goals from Christopher Katongo and Nathan Sinkala put Zambia 2-0 up after 29 minutes at Raymond James Stadium before Honda pulled one back from the penalty spot shortly before halftime.
